Detailed explanation-1: -Auxins function primarily in stem elongation by promoting cell growth. Indole-3-acetic acid (IAA) is the major naturally occurring auxin and one of the major growth factors in plants. They were the first group of plant growth hormones discovered. Auxins serve dual roles in plants depending on where they are produced.

Detailed explanation-3: -Gibberellins are plant growth regulators that facilitate cell elongation, help the plants to grow taller. They also play major roles in germination, elongation of the stem, fruit ripening and flowering.

Detailed explanation-4: -They stimulate cell elongation, breaking and budding, seedless fruits, and seed germination. Gibberellins cause seed germination by breaking the seed’s dormancy and acting as a chemical messenger.

Detailed explanation-5: -Gibberellins are a group of plant hormones responsible for growth and development. They are important for initiating seed germination . Low concentrations can be used to increase the speed of germination, and they stimulate cell elongation so plants grow taller. They are naturally produced by barley and other seeds.
